Glass Repair Door Cost Breakdown
The cost of fixing or replacing a glass door differs extensively depending upon the type of glass, the size of the door, labor rates, and the extent of the damage.
Service TypeTypical Cost Range (GBP)DescriptionSmall Chip/Crack Repair₤ 50-- ₤ 150Resin injection for little, non-spreading cracks.Single-Pane Replacement₤ 100-- ₤ 300Changing a standard, non-tempered glass pane.Tempered Glass Replacement₤ 200-- ₤ 600Custom-cut shatterproof glass for sliding or patio area doors.Insulated Glass Unit (IGU)₤ 300-- ₤ 850Changing a dual-pane seal failure system.Sliding Door Roller Repair₤ 150-- ₤ 350Replacing damaged tracks and rollers to fix sticking doors.Emergency Board-Up & & Repair₤ 250-- ₤ 600+After-hours emergency situation service for broken storefronts/doors.
Note: Prices exclude labor in many cases and might vary based upon geographic location and emergency call-out charges.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Can a broken glass door be fixed, or does it always need replacement?
In many cases, if the glass is cracked-- particularly if it is tempered safety glass-- it can not be safely repaired and should be changed. Minor chips on the surface of thick glass can sometimes be filled with resin, but any crack that jeopardizes the structural stability of the door requires a brand-new glass pane.
2. For how long does it take to change the glass in a door?
If the glass is a basic size and kept in stock by a local glazier, the real replacement process normally takes between one to 2 hours. Nevertheless, if custom-tempered glass or a specialized insulated glass unit need to be ordered, it can take anywhere from 3 to 10 company days.
3. Will house owners insurance cover glass door repair?
It depends upon the reason for the damage. If the glass was broken throughout a burglary, extreme storm, or vandalism, homeowner's insurance coverage typically covers the repair cost, minus the deductible. Damage triggered by typical wear and tear or accidental self-inflicted damage is typically not covered.
4. How can moving glass doors be kept to prevent future issues?
Regular maintenance goes a long way. Homeowner ought to vacuum tracks routinely to remove dirt and particles, lubricate rollers and emergency window Repair tracks with a silicone-based spray (avoiding heavy grease that brings in dirt), and examine weatherstripping annually for signs of destruction.
